Târgu Neamţ

Târgu Neamț is a town in , , , on the river . It had, as of 2021, a population of 18,029. Three villages are administered by the town: Blebea, Humulești, and Humuleștii Noi.

Museum
The Memorial House of Ion Creangă is a Historic Monument located in Humulești, . The building was the home of Romanian writer Ion Creangă in the latter's childhood from his birth in 1837 until 1855.
